请根据下图所示网络结构回答问题。 填写路由器RG的路由表项①至⑥。

admin2019-07-05  24

问题 请根据下图所示网络结构回答问题。

填写路由器RG的路由表项①至⑥。

选项

答案①路由器RG的S0端口是由IP地址202.13.47.254和202.13.47.253组成的微型网络,求网络号的方法是将两个IP地址转换成二进制,然后找相同位。不同位取0与相同的位一起组成的IP地址即为网络号。 [*] 转换成十进制得:202.13.47.252,相同位有30位,因此子网掩码是/30。故①处应填入:202.13.47.252/30。 ②路由器RG的S1端口是由IP地址202.13.47.250和202.13.47.249组成的微型网络,求网络号的方法是将两个IP地址转换成二进制,然后找相同位。不同位取0与相同的位一起组成的IP地址即为网络号。 [*] 转换成十进制得:202.13.47.248,相同位有30位,因此子网掩码是/30。故②处应填入:202.13.47.248/30。 ③第3行S0的网络应由202.13.147.72、202.13.147.73和202.13.147.74组成的微型网络,求网络号的方法是将3个IP地址转换成二进制,然后找相同位。不同位取0与相同位一起组成的IP地址即为网络号。 [*] 转换成十进制得:202.13.147.72,相同位有30位。该网络已经有3个IP地址,可以分配的IP地址肯定需要2n一2≥3,得n的最小取值为3,即子网掩码最少是29位才能满足该网络的最少需求。但是202.13.147.72已经配给RF路由器的E0端口,所以子网掩码只能取28位才不会引起端口号的冲突。故③应填入:202.13.147.64/28。 ④第3行S1的网络应由202.13.147.56、202.13.147.57和202.13.147.58组成的微型网络,求网络号的方法是将3个IP地址转换成二进制,然后找相同位。不同位取0与相同位一起组成的IP地址即为网络号。 [*] 转换成十进制得:202.13.147.56,相同位有30位。该网络已经有3个IP地址,可以分配的IP地址肯定需要2n一2≥3,得n的最小取值为3,即子网掩码最少是29位才能满足该网络的最少需求。但是202.13.147.56已经配给RE路由器的E2端口,所以子网掩码只能取28位才不会引起端口号的冲突。故④应填入:202.13.147.48/28。 ⑤第4行的S0的网络应由RC的E0、E1端口所在的网络202.13.157.0/24、202.13.156.0/24与RD的E0、E1端口所在的网络202.13.159.0/24、202.13.158.0/24组成的微型网络,根据①处的计算方法得:202.13.156.0/22。故⑤处应填入:202.13.156.0/22。 ⑥第4行的S1的网络应由RA的E0、E1端口所在的网络202.13.149.0/24、202.13.148.0/24与RB的E0、E1端口所在的网络202.13.151.0/24、202.13.150.0/24组成的微型网络,根据①处的计算方法得:202.13.148.0/22。故⑥处应填入:202.13.148.0/22。

解析 本题主要考查的是路由汇聚、子网划分及其相关知识。
    路由汇聚的“用意”是采用了一种体系化编址规划后的一种用一个IP地址代表一组IP地址的集合的方法。除了缩小路由表的尺寸之外,路由汇聚还能通过在网络连接断开之后限制路由通信的传播来提高网络的稳定性。
    假设有下面4个路由:
    172.18.129.0/24
    172.18.130.0/24
    172.18.132.0/24
    172.18.133.0/24
    算法为:129的二进制代码是10000001;130的二进制代码是10000010;132的二进制代码是10000100;133的二进制代码是10000101。
    这四个数的前五位相同,都是10000,所以加上前面的172.18这两部分相同位数的网络号是8+8+5=21位。而10000000的十进制数是128,所以,路由汇聚的IP地址就是172.18.128.0。即汇聚后的网络是172.18.128.0/21。
    子网划分:在国际互联网上有成千上万台主机,为了区分这些主机,人们给每台主机都分配了一个专门的地址作为标识,称为IP地址。子网掩码的作用是用来区分网络上的主机是否在同一网络段内,它不能单独存在,而必须结合IP地址一起使用。
转载请注明原文地址:https://jikaoti.com/ti/has7FFFM
0

最新回复(0)